OKLAHOMA CITY -- A water main break in Oklahoma City has forced the city to issue a watering ban in parts of the metro.
A 60-inch water pipe broke early Sunday morning and customers downtown and in the northeast and northwest Oklahoma City have been affected
The watering ban includes from May to Douglas, between Northwest 50th Street and the Oklahoma River. It also includes downtown and the state capitol complex.
This is just a temporary ban until the water line is fixed. The break is expected to be fixed by tomorrow afternoon.
